2. Material Innovations: From Ancient Objects to Modern Safety Gear

Drawing parallels from How Ancient Tools and Candies Inspire Modern Safety Strategies, the evolution of materials used in safety gear reveals a journey from natural durability to advanced synthetic composites. Ancient civilizations utilized materials like animal hides, wood, and clay, which offered a certain resilience but often lacked the consistency and scientific properties needed for modern safety equipment.

The transition to synthetic materials—such as high-density plastics, impact-absorbing foams, and smart textiles—has revolutionized safety gear. For instance, the development of helmets with expanded polystyrene foam layers mimics the shock-absorbing properties of ancient padded clothing but with vastly improved performance and reliability. These innovations are inspired by a deep understanding of material science, but often draw conceptual parallels from everyday objects, such as the resilience of natural fibers or the cushioning of ancient clay containers.

Fascinatingly, the role of everyday objects in pioneering safety gear is evident in the design of modern knee pads, which borrow from the natural cushioning found in certain plant-based materials used historically in cushioning fragile items like pottery or tools.

3. Behavioral Insights: How Play and Object Interaction Shape Safety Protocols

Understanding children’s risk-taking behaviors through historical play patterns provides valuable insights into designing safer environments. Historically, children engaged in physically demanding games with minimal restrictions, fostering resilience but also exposing them to injuries. Recognizing these behaviors informs the development of safety protocols that balance freedom with protection.

Familiar objects, such as tools or candies, influence risk perception significantly. For example, children’s attachment to familiar objects like carved wooden toys or simple metal tools in ancient societies often encouraged safe interaction through symbolic familiarity. Modern safety protocols leverage this by incorporating familiar elements—such as soft, rounded edges or colorful, approachable designs—to reduce anxiety and promote safe play.

Research in behavioral science suggests that when environments incorporate familiar, non-threatening objects, children are more likely to comply with safety rules, reducing accidents. A practical application is the use of familiar, rounded shapes in playground equipment, echoing ancient rounded stones or pottery, which naturally discourage injury.

4. Design Principles Derived from Ancient and Everyday Objects for Modern Safety

Fundamental design principles such as simplicity and robustness are timeless and deeply rooted in ancient craftsmanship. For instance, the enduring popularity of wooden structures in playgrounds reflects a preference for natural, sturdy materials that age gracefully and withstand wear—principles echoed in ancient construction methods where simplicity ensured durability.

Intuitive design plays a crucial role in preventing accidents; ancient tools and objects were often designed for ease of use, with clear, simple forms requiring minimal instruction. Modern playgrounds adopt this by creating equipment with straightforward operation—think of slide handles or swing chains designed for intuitive grip—reducing misuse and injury.

Incorporating familiar objects, such as rounded stones or wooden logs, into safety features can help reduce anxiety. For example, soft, rounded edges on modern equipment mirror the smooth contours of ancient polished stones, making the environment feel safe and approachable.
